Singer Morgan James, whose parents encouraged her to explore the arts as a child, “hit the ground running” when she moved to New York when she was 18 to study at Juilliard. She signed a record deal a mere week before recording her first solo album, Morgan James Live: A Celebration of Nina Simone. She is touring in support of Nobody's Fool, a return to her R&B roots.
